Dogecoin (DOGE), the popular meme-based cryptocurrency, could be heading for a significant drop before the weekend, according to analysts. Despite its resilience in the altcoin market, recent price action suggests that DOGE might be losing momentum, potentially leading to an ‘ugly’ decline in the short term.
Dogecoin’s Recent Price Action
Dogecoin has seen strong price fluctuations in recent weeks, mirroring the broader crypto market’s volatility. While DOGE has attempted multiple breakouts, resistance at key price levels has held firm, preventing further gains.
At the time of writing, Dogecoin is trading around $0.08 – $0.09, struggling to sustain upward momentum. Analysts have pointed out that a lack of bullish volume and increased selling pressure could push DOGE into a downward spiral.
Why Analysts Predict a Drop for DOGE
🔴 1. Weak Market Momentum
DOGE has been experiencing lower trading volumes, a signal that interest in the asset may be waning. Without strong buying pressure, Dogecoin risks a further downturn, especially if Bitcoin and the broader market see corrections.
📉 2. Technical Indicators Flash Bearish Signals
- RSI (Relative Strength Index): The RSI for DOGE is trending downward, suggesting a loss of bullish momentum.
- MACD (Moving Average Convergence Divergence): A potential bearish crossover on the MACD indicator signals that sellers may take control.
- Support Levels: Analysts highlight $0.075 – $0.08 as key support zones. If DOGE fails to hold these levels, a sharper decline could follow.
💰 3. Broader Market Uncertainty
The overall crypto market remains volatile, with Bitcoin and Ethereum facing resistance at higher levels. Since meme coins like DOGE tend to follow overall market sentiment, any BTC correction could trigger an accelerated decline for Dogecoin.
